KICK OVER THE TRACES


Meaning of KICK OVER THE TRACES in English

phrasal to cast off restraint, authority, or control

Merriam Webster. Explanatory English dictionary Merriam Webster.      Толковый словарь английского языка Мерриам-Уэбстер.